Warwick Police have identified the pedestrian struck by a truck while crossing a dimly lit area of Bald Hill Road Wednesday night. 

Gustavo Lopez Giron of Plainfield Street in Providence was killed after being struck by an older model Ford F-150 as he entered the northbound side of the roadway in the area of 1170 Bald Hill Road. Police say the Ford was operating northbound in the left-hand lane. The vehicle’s driver and several witnesses stopped immediately after the collision to render aid and fully cooperate with police.

Police say the initial investigation determined that speed, alcohol and distracted driving do not appear to be factors in this crash and that Lopez Giron was not in a crosswalk at the time of the accident.
